School Closing

Dear Famlies,

As you are aware, school will be closed again tomorrow, Friday November 2, 2012 and will reopen on Monday, November 5, 2012. Also, please know that school will NOT be closed on Tuesday, November 6. Previously, the staff was due to attend a conference that day, and will we not be going. This will be a regular day of school with after school. I will be examining the calendar and announcing other changes to make up some of the days we have lost.



I am aware that some of you have wondered why we are closed when the Astoria community has already rebounded from that storm. Please know that I have been monitoring the situation and have made my decisions based on information from the mayor's office, the NYC Department of Education, and information provided by the Lutheran Schools Association, in consultation with our teaching and support staffs, and Pastor James. There are many factors to consider beyond whether the building has heat and power or not. Some of these other issues include pupil transportation and adequate teaching coverage to name just some of the other factors.
